phpexcel 날짜 형식 및 값 읽기 문제
본문
엑셀을 업로드하여 서버에 입력하려는데
2021-02-26 10:03 |
엑셀파일의 값이 위와 같은데, 실제로 엑셀을 업로드하면,
27/02/2021 19:03으로 올라가기에,
reader.php파일에서
0x16 => "d/m/Y H:i", 를 이렇게 0x16 => "Y-m-d H:i", 변경하였더니,
날짜는 아래와 같이 원하는 형태로 변경이 되었지만, 변환되는 실제 데이터의 값이
2021-02-27 19:03
변화되지 않는데 혹시 도움 주실수 있으실지요?
답변 1
액셀에서 읽어온 값에서 33시간 빼면 됩니다
0x16 => "d/m/Y H:i", 를 이렇게 0x16 => "Y-m-d H:i", 변경하였더니, <--변경할 필요도 없이 우리 실정에 맞는 형식으로 바꾸면 됩니다
$date = date("Y-m-d H:i:s", strtotime("$readDate -33 hour"));
답변을 작성하시기 전에 로그인 해주세요.